Rosa Neuenschwander
Rosa Neuenschwander (born April 3, 1883 in Brienz , † December 20, 1962 in Bern ) was a Bernese pioneer in the field of career counseling and vocational training in Switzerland .
She was the first career counselor in Bern and on her initiative several social services for young people and women were founded. The two most important associations she initiated are the Swiss Women's Trade Association and the Swiss Rural Women's Association (SLFV) .
